Overview of the 1986 FORD E150

The 1986 FORD E150 has received a total of 12 safety complaints filed with the National Highway Traffic Safety Administration (NHTSA). The most commonly reported problems involve the Electrical Systemignitionswitch (3 complaints), Electrical Systemalternatorgeneratorregulator (1 complaint), and Electrical Systemwiringfront Underhood (1 complaint).

#10007321 | VEHICLE SPEED CONTROL | | N/A miles
THE THROTTLE STUCK, WHICH CAUSED UNWANTED SUDDEN ACCELERATION. ON ONE OCCASION THE THROTTLE BODY WAS DIRTY AND ON ANOTHER OCCASION, WITH THE CRUISE CONTROL ON, THE VACUUM LINE MALFUNCTIONED. IN EITHER CASE, PRESSING DOWN ON THE BRAKE PEDAL DID NOT STOP THE VEHICLE. THE ONLY WAY TO STOP THE VEHICLE WAS TO TURN OFF THE IGNITION. *TT *JB
#10009086 | VEHICLE SPEED CONTROL:CRUISE CONTROL | | N/A miles
THE CRUISE CONTROL VACUUM LINE HAD KINKED WHILE THR CRUISE WAS ON, THE THROTTLE BODY HAD STUCK, AND THE BRAKE PEDAL HAD BECOME INOPERATIVE. SCC *JB
